Cucumbers and gherkins — Producer Price in Pakistan
Pakistan: Cucumbers and gherkins — Producer Price was 72,670 SLC in 2024. ▲ Rising
Cucumbers and gherkins — Producer Price in Pakistan, 2020–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in SLC.
Analysis
The most recent figure for cucumbers and gherkins — producer price in Pakistan is 72,670 SLC,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 5 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 17.3% on the previous year and up 79.5% over five years.
That places Pakistan 27th out of 103 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
Cucumbers and gherkins — Producer Price in Pakistan, year by year
| Year | SLC |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2020 | 40,480 SLC | — |
| 2021 | 40,139 SLC | -0.8% |
| 2022 | 51,902 SLC | +29.3% |
| 2023 | 61,938 SLC | +19.3% |
| 2024 | 72,670 SLC | +17.3% |

About this data
This sub-domain contains data on agriculture producer prices and the producer price index. Agriculture producer prices are prices received by farmers for primary crops, live animals and livestock primary products as collected at the point of initial sale (prices paid at the farm gate). Annual data are provided from 1991 (while mothly data start in January 2010) for 180 countries and 212 products. The producer price index is the index of agricultural producer prices that measures the average annual change over time in the selling prices received by farmers (prices at the farm gate or at the first point of sale). The three categories of producer price index available in FAOSTAT comprise: single-item price index, commodity group index and the agriculture producer price index.
